🧠 If your kids are active and enjoy exercising, this is the perfect opportunity to get them interested in practicing English they’ll like and find useful. By listening to workout-related vocabulary and expressions as they work out themselves, children are learning practical and natural English.

This workout series is based on kinesthetic learning and activates physical memory. Children learn by moving their bodies.

🗣 Vocabulary you’ll hear and use in this video: jump rope, side to side, to switch, to hop, to jog, to stretch, airplane arms, over and back, toes, to put your hands together, to lean, forward/backwards, to sit down, butterfly, legs, to bring your feet together, elbows, to push your legs out, to push your knees down, nose, shoulders, waist, to bend, right/left, to tuck in your leg, back, straight, further down, forehead, high five.
